Combating Macro Viruses: Strategies for Secure Systems

Bisma Farrukh

Bisma Farrukh

March 7, 2025
Updated on March 7, 2025
Combating Macro Viruses: Strategies for Secure Systems

As a technology professional, you’re likely familiar with various cybersecurity threats. However, one often-overlooked danger lurking in your systems could be macro viruses. These insidious programs hide within seemingly innocuous documents, waiting to wreak havoc on your network. Unlike traditional viruses, macro viruses exploit the very tools you rely on daily, such as word processors and spreadsheets. Their ability to spread rapidly and remain undetected makes them a formidable opponent in the realm of digital security. In this article, you’ll discover effective strategies to identify, prevent, and combat macro viruses, ensuring your systems remain secure and your data is protected from this persistent threat.

Understanding Macro Viruses: What is Macro Virus and How Do They Work?

Macro viruses are a unique breed of malware that exploits the macro programming capabilities in popular software applications. Unlike traditional viruses, these malicious programs embed themselves within document files, such as those created by Microsoft Office.

Anatomy of a Macro Virus

Macro viruses typically consist of code written in the application’s macro language, like Visual Basic for Applications (VBA) in Microsoft Office. When an infected document is opened, the virus executes automatically, potentially spreading to other files or systems.

Infection and Propagation

These viruses spread when users unknowingly share infected documents. Once activated, they can replicate themselves, corrupt files, or even steal sensitive information. Their ability to hide within seemingly innocuous files makes them particularly insidious and challenging to detect without proper security measures in place.

What does a macro virus do?

A macro virus is malicious software that embeds itself within application macros, typically in programs like Microsoft Office. These viruses exploit application automation features to spread and execute harmful actions. When an infected file is opened, the macro virus activates and can perform a range of malicious activities.

Common malicious actions

Macro viruses often:

  • Replicate themselves by infecting other files
  • Delete or corrupt data on the infected system
  • Steal sensitive information like passwords
  • Send spam emails to contacts in the address book
  • Download additional macro malware to the computer

Stealthy nature

What makes macro viruses particularly dangerous is their ability to hide within legitimate-looking documents. They can spread rapidly through email attachments or shared files, often evading traditional antivirus software. This stealthy nature allows them to infiltrate systems and networks undetected, potentially causing widespread damage before being discovered.

The Dangers of Macro Viruses

Macro viruses pose a significant threat to your computer systems and sensitive data. These malicious programs exploit the power of macros automated tasks in software like Microsoft Office to spread and wreak havoc. Unlike traditional viruses, macro viruses can infect documents and spreadsheets, making them particularly insidious.

Stealthy Infiltration

Macro viruses often arrive disguised as harmless attachments, tricking users into opening infected files. Once activated, they can replicate themselves, corrupting other documents on your system and potentially spreading across networks.

Data Compromise and System Damage

The consequences of a macro virus infection can be severe. These viruses may steal confidential information, delete crucial files, or even take control of your email to propagate further. In some cases, they can render entire systems inoperable, leading to costly downtime and data loss.

Evolving Threats

As security measures improve, macro viruses continue to evolve, becoming more sophisticated and harder to detect. Staying vigilant and implementing robust security practices is crucial to protect your digital assets from these persistent threats.

Common Macro Virus Infection Vectors: Identifying and Mitigating Risks

Email Attachments and Downloads

Email remains a primary vector for macro virus transmission. Malicious actors often embed macros in seemingly innocuous attachments like Word documents or Excel spreadsheets. When opened, these files can execute harmful code. To mitigate this risk, configure email filters to block suspicious file types and educate users about the dangers of enabling macros in unsolicited attachments.

Shared Network Drives and Cloud Storage

Infected files on shared network drives or cloud storage platforms can rapidly spread macro viruses across an organization. Implement strict access controls, regularly scan shared resources for malware, and use version control systems to track and revert malicious changes. Additionally, consider deploying data loss prevention (DLP) tools to monitor and restrict the movement of sensitive information.

Macro Virus Detection and Removal

Identifying and eliminating macro viruses is crucial for maintaining secure systems. These malicious programs, which embed themselves in documents and spreadsheets, can wreak havoc if left unchecked. To protect your organization, implement a multi-layered approach to detection and removal.

Proactive Scanning

Utilize robust antivirus software with up-to-date virus definitions to regularly scan all files and email attachments. Look for solutions that offer real-time protection and heuristic analysis to catch even the newest macro virus variants.

User Education

Empower your team with knowledge about macro virus risks. Train employees to recognize suspicious files and enable macro content only from trusted sources. Encourage a “think before you click” mentality to reduce the risk of infection.

Macro Security Settings

Leverage built-in security features in office applications. Configure macro settings to disable automatic execution and prompt users for permission. This extra layer of control can significantly mitigate the spread of macro viruses across your network.

How does AstrillVPN help in combating macro viruses?

AstrillVPN provides robust protection against macro viruses by creating a secure, encrypted tunnel for your internet traffic. This encryption prevents malicious actors from intercepting and injecting macro viruses into your system. Additionally, AstrillVPN’s advanced firewall feature blocks suspicious incoming connections that may contain macro viruses.

Enhanced Security Features

AstrillVPN offers:

  • Regular security updates to combat emerging threats
  • DNS leak protection to prevent exposure of your online activities
  • Kill switch functionality to ensure your data remains protected even if the VPN connection drops

By masking your IP address and location, AstrillVPN makes it significantly harder for cybercriminals to target your system with macro viruses. This multi-layered approach to security provides comprehensive protection against various online threats, including macro viruses.

How to prevent macro viruses?

  • Implement a multi-layered defense strategy to safeguard your systems against macro viruses.
  • Start by keeping all software, especially office suites and antivirus programs, up-to-date.
  • Enable macro security settings in your applications, configuring them to disable macros by default or only allow digitally signed macros from trusted sources.

User education and vigilance

  • Train employees to recognize potential threats and exercise caution when opening email attachments or downloading files from unknown sources.
  •  Encourage a “think before you click” mentality to reduce the risk of inadvertently activating malicious macros.

Technical safeguards

  • Utilize robust antivirus software with real-time scanning capabilities.
  • Implement email filters to block suspicious attachments and employ network segmentation to limit the spread of potential infections.
  • Regular system backups are crucial for quick recovery in case of a breach.

By combining these preventive measures, you can significantly reduce the risk of macro virus infections and maintain a secure computing environment.

Macro Virus examples

Macro viruses are among the most insidious threats to computer security. These malicious programs exploit the macro programming capabilities in popular software applications.

  • One notorious example is the Melissa virus, which spread rapidly through Microsoft Word documents in 1999. It hijacked users’ email accounts to propagate itself, causing widespread disruption.
  • Another infamous macro virus is the Concept virus, discovered in 1995. It was one of the first to target Microsoft Word, infecting documents and spreading to other files when opened. The ILOVEYOU virus, while not strictly a macro virus, used similar techniques to wreak havoc in 2000, demonstrating the potential for a devastating impact.
  • More recent examples include the Dridex banking trojan, which often uses macro-enabled Office documents as its initial infection vector. These examples highlight the ongoing threat posed by macro viruses and the importance of robust security measures.

Conclusion

In conclusion, combating macro viruses requires a multi-faceted approach to secure your systems. By implementing robust antivirus software, keeping all applications updated, disabling macros by default, and educating users about safe practices, you can significantly reduce the risk of infection. Remember to regularly back up your data and have an incident response plan in place. As macro viruses continue to evolve, staying vigilant and adapting your security measures accordingly is crucial. By following the strategies outlined in this article, you can create a strong defense against these persistent threats and protect your organization’s valuable digital assets. Remain proactive in your cybersecurity efforts to stay one step ahead of malicious actors.

FAQs

Understanding Macro Viruses

Is a macro a type of malicious code? Yes, macros can be used maliciously. A macro virus is written in a macro language and embedded within documents or spreadsheets. These viruses exploit the automation features in programs like Microsoft Office to execute harmful code.

Vulnerable Programs

What programs are more likely affected by a macro virus? Microsoft Office applications, particularly Word and Excel, are prime targets. These programs’ powerful macro capabilities make them susceptible to infection. However, any software supporting macros can potentially be affected.

Prevention Strategies

To protect against macro viruses, disable macros by default in your applications. Only enable macros for trusted documents. Keep your software updated and use reputable antivirus programs. Be cautious when opening email attachments or downloading files from unknown sources.

Was this article helpful?
Thanks for your feedback!

About The Author

Bisma Farrukh

Bisma is a seasoned writer passionate about topics like cybersecurity, privacy and data breach issues. She has been working in VPN industry for more than 5 years now and loves to talk about security issues. She loves to explore the books and travel guides in her leisure time.

No comments were posted yet

Leave a Reply

Your email address will not be published.


CAPTCHA Image
Reload Image